Agon
Originally released in 2012. Agon is a drama film. directed by Robert Budina.
Starring Marvin Tafaj, Guliem Kotorri, and Antonis Kafetzopoulos
Synopsis
Two Albanian brothers migrate to Greece and try, each in his own way, to integrate into their host country by following two different lifestyles.
